logo

Output 3d636360e6478713087c4a95f2e75ced31ef3e07e14b1c175ec4d1993f734ca4:1

value
28884232
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 168bc653f99aac6271310694cdcfc27134bceec2 OP_EQUALVERIFY OP_CHECKSIG
address
134DJwQQk5aBxEGdui8qRE56hSj1jLs4SL
transaction
3d636360e6478713087c4a95f2e75ced31ef3e07e14b1c175ec4d1993f734ca4